      <description>An Inside Look at the New VanceInfo &amp;amp;ldquo;LGE 100&amp;#8480;&amp;amp;rdquo; with Jeff Wu, VanceInfo Chief Globalization Officer and Arthur Hagopian, VanceInfo Localization, Globalization and Engineering (LGE) Senior ManagerA Tea for Thought columnist met with VanceInfo&amp;amp;rsquo;s Jeff Wu and Arthur Hagopian on a wintry Beijing afternoon to share a cup of tea and learn about The VanceInfo &amp;amp;ldquo;LGE 100&amp;#8480;&amp;amp;rdquo;.To start off our conversation, Jeff reminded Tea for Thought that VanceInfo&amp;amp;rsquo;s original service line, in 1995, was localization of software products, a core competency that later grew into the current Localization, Globalization and Engineering (LGE) practice. Though the company has since branched out into serving additional vertical markets and providing complete service offerings &amp;amp;ndash; such as financial services and IT consulting &amp;amp;ndash; the ever-growing demand for LGE services from clients worldwide has spurred continued investment in this core b...</description>

      <description>Jiantao Pan, CTO of North America Business Group and Head of Cloud Computing at VanceInfo, provides his global perspective in this one-on-one interview that combines a story of personal growth with industry trends. A &amp;amp;lsquo;Tea for Thought&amp;amp;rsquo; columnist met with VanceInfo&amp;amp;rsquo;s Jiantao Pan on a nippy Beijing March afternoon to share a cup of tea and swap ideas with this international executive. &amp;amp;ldquo;It&amp;amp;rsquo;s my passion to give companies a global perspective,&amp;amp;rdquo; stated Jiantao &amp;amp;ldquo;JT&amp;amp;rdquo; Pan when asked about his most comprehensive professional goals. Originally a native of Harbin, a large industrial city in China&amp;amp;rsquo;s frigid north, JT completed his undergraduate degree in China before heading to Pittsburgh&amp;amp;rsquo;s Carnegie Mellon University to study for his Ph.D. Though JT now promulgates an international awareness, his first experiences in Pittsburgh were with &amp;amp;ldquo;regional&amp;amp;rdquo; discrimination. &amp;amp;ldquo;There w...</description>
